'Meteorology': Extreme heat expected in some regions of the Kingdom until next Saturday
The National Center of Meteorology expects the continuation of hot to extremely hot weather across several regions of the Kingdom in the coming days, with maximum temperatures ranging between 47 and 49 degrees Celsius in parts of the Eastern Province and the eastern and southern parts of Riyadh region, starting from tomorrow, Monday, until Saturday, July 25.
The center explained that maximum temperatures are expected to range between 47 and 49 degrees Celsius in parts of the Eastern Province, as well as the eastern and southern parts of Riyadh region, during the period from July 20 to 25.

It also pointed to the continuation of hot weather in parts of Makkah, Madinah, and Al-Qassim regions, where maximum temperatures are expected to range between 46 and 48 degrees Celsius during the period from July 20 to 22.
The center urged everyone to follow weather updates and warnings issued via its website, official social media accounts, and the "Anwaa" application to stay informed of the latest forecasts and instructions regarding the weather conditions, and to take necessary precautions, especially during peak hours, to avoid direct exposure to sunlight and high temperatures.
